                          SHAMIR OPTICAL INDUSTRY LTD.
                      REPORTS SECOND QUARTER 2009 RESULTS

     KIBBUTZ SHAMIR, ISRAEL, AUGUST 13, 2009 - Shamir Optical Industry Ltd.
(Nasdaq: SHMR) ("SHAMIR"), a leading provider of innovative products and
technology to the ophthalmic lens market, today announced unaudited financial
results for the second quarter ended June 30, 2009.

     For the quarter ended June 30, 2009, revenues were $35.2 million, compared
with revenues of $37.1 million for the same period in 2008. The decrease in
revenues was mainly due to the decrease in the value of the Euro versus the US
dollar between the comparable quarters. Gross profit for the quarter was $19.0
million, or 53.8% of revenues, compared with gross profit of $20.1 million, or
54.3% of revenues for the same period last year.

     For the quarter ended June 30, 2009, operating income increased by 25.0% to
$4.1 million, or 11.6% of revenues, compared with operating income of $3.3
million, or 8.8% of revenues for the same period last year. Net income for the
quarter increased by 39.1% to $3.9 million compared with net income of $2.8
million for the comparable period in 2008. Net income attributable to Shamir's
shareholders was $0.22 per diluted share, compared with $0.16 per diluted share
for the same period in 2008

     For the quarter ended June 30, 2009, excluding the effect of non-cash
stock-based compensation expenses, amortization of intangible assets and
compensation to the Company's former chief executive officers, operating income
increased by 22.5% to $4.8 million, or 13.6% of revenues, compared with
operating income of $3.9 million, or 10.5% of revenues, for the same period last
year.

     Excluding the effect of non-cash stock-based compensation expenses,
amortization of intangible assets and compensation to the Company's former chief
executive officers, net of tax, net income attributable to Shamir's shareholders
for the quarter was $4.3 million, or $0.26 per diluted share, compared with net
income of $3.2 million, or $0.19 per diluted share for the same period last
year.

     The reconciliation of GAAP operating income and GAAP net income to non-GAAP
operating income and non-GAAP net income is set forth below.

     As of June 30, 2009, the Company had cash and cash equivalents, including
short-term investments of $27.4 million.

     Commenting on the results, Amos Netzer, Chief Executive Officer of Shamir,
said, "During the past few years, Shamir has worked diligently, not only to
expand our geographic footprint, but also to improve our manufacturing
capabilities and solidify and expand our sales and marketing capabilities. The
positive effect of these efforts is reflected in our favorable results for the
second quarter. In Europe, we generated improved sales and operating results and
our operations in the United States continued to perform well."




SHAMIR / PAGE 2

     Mr. Netzer added, "To support our long range goals of expanding our selling
and manufacturing capabilities, in July 2009 we increased our ownership in our
lab in Thailand from 40.4% to 51%. We are very encouraged with the performance
of our investment in Thailand and are pleased to have been able to increase our
ownership in the subsidiary."

     Mr. Netzer concluded, "In terms of our overall strategy, we continue to
maintain a strong balance between investing in long-term growth and monitoring
operational expenses, which helped us achieve positive performance thus far this
year. However, due to the uncertainty in the global economic landscape and the
remaining challenges, our visibility for the second half of 2009 is unclear."

ABOUT SHAMIR

Shamir is a leading provider of innovative products and technology to the
spectacle lens market. Utilizing its proprietary technology, the company
develops, designs, manufactures, and markets progressive lenses to sell to the
ophthalmic market. In addition, Shamir utilizes its technology to provide design
services to optical lens manufacturers under service and royalty agreements.
Progressive lenses are used to treat presbyopia, a vision condition where the
eye loses its ability to focus on close objects. Progressive lenses combine
several optical strengths into a single lens to provide a gradual and seamless
transition from near to intermediate, to distant vision. Shamir differentiates
its products from its competitors' primarily through lens design. Shamir's
leading lenses are marketed under a variety of trade names, including Shamir
Genesis(TM), Shamir Piccolo(TM), Shamir Office(TM), Shamir Nano(TM), Shamir
Autograph(TM) and Shamir Smart(TM). Shamir believes that it has one of the
world's preeminent research and development teams for progressive lenses, molds,
and complementary technologies and tools. Shamir developed software dedicated to
the design of progressive lenses. This software is based on Shamir's proprietary
mathematical algorithms that optimize designs of progressive lenses for a
variety of activities and environments. Shamir also has created software tools
specifically designed for research and development and production requirements,
including Eye Point Technology software, which simulates human vision.
